Benefits of a software

Among the main benefits of a software, it is possible to highlight the saving of time, as well as work and money, not to mention the ease in carrying out management tasks and the increase in the precision and efficiency of operations.

In addition, with well-developed software, it is possible to store the most varied types of data with complete security. This tool also contributes to the reduction of human errors and helps monitor all the processes of a business.

Types of software most used by companies

Among the types of software most used by companies, those of CRM, marketing automation, and structuring and productivity tools stand out.

CRM (customer relationship management) aims to optimize the marketing and sales sectors of a business, with the primary function of collecting essential data through Big Data and the company’s relationship history with its base from clients.

Marketing automation tools help the company when the objective is to maintain a close relationship with customers and prospects. With it, it is still possible to create processes to capture new customers using all the data collected with the CRM, generating campaigns that would be impossible to execute manually.

Regarding structuring and productivity tools, the objective is to offer services to structure projects that need to be carried out in stages, generate efficient results, and optimize the process.
